What Are German News Words?
German news words are specialized vocabulary used in German-language news reporting. They are often technical terms or words that have specific meanings in the context of news and politics. Knowing these words can help you better understand German news articles and broadcasts.

Common German News Words
Here is a list of some common German news words:
Bundestag: German parliament
Bundeskanzler: Federal Chancellor
Bundespräsident: Federal President
Bundesregierung: Federal Government
Bundestagwahl: Federal parliamentary election
Europäische Union: European Union
Nordatlantikpakt-Organisation: North Atlantic Treaty Organization (NATO)
Vereinte Nationen: United Nations
Wirtschaft: Economy
Politik: Politics
Gesellschaft: Society
Kultur: Culture
